Expert Verdict
Data gap: No CIR or SCCS monograph. Benzoic acid is restricted in EU Annex V (preservative, max 2.5% as acid in leave-on, 5% rinse-off), but this pertains to free acid, not the ester; hydrolysis potential should be assessed; HRIPT recommended at intended use level

What does Hexyldecyl Benzoate do in cosmetics?
Hexyldecyl Benzoate functions as: Skin conditioning — emollient (alkyl ester of benzoic acid). It is classified as a cosmetic ingredient in our database. CAS number: Not well-established in public databases.
